Homenaje a Dos Leyendas (2010)

Homenaje a Dos Leyendas 2010 (Spanish for "Homage to Two Legends") was an annual professional wrestling major event produced by Consejo Mundial de Lucha Libre (CMLL), which took place on March 19, 2010 in Arena México, Mexico City, Mexico. The event paid tribute to CMLL founder Salvador Lutteroth who is always honored at Dos Leyendas and to Ray Mendoza, the father of Los Villanos (I, II, III, IV and V). The main event was a tag team elimination match with Volador Jr. and La Sombra facing Místico and El Felino. The first two wrestlers eliminated from the match were then be forced to face off in a Lucha de Apuestas match with their masks on the line.
